Summary

Especially useful in combination with GitHub saved replies.

Possible placeholders are:

{repo_name} inserts the name of the repository {repo_url} inserts the full URL of the repositoy {author} inserts the @name of the author of the issue {owner} inserts the @owner of the repository {owner_url} inserts the full URL of the owner of the repository

Additionally you can add some string modifier to each placeholder:

{upper_case_repo_name} 'github-enhanced-comments' becomes 'GITHUB-ENHANCED-COMMENTS' {camel_case_repo_name} 'github-enhanced-comments' becomes 'githubEnhancedComments'
